| Obverse description | Central field of the nordic gold inner disc depicts a detailed frontal view of the Bratislava National Theatre, a neoclassical building with a prominent colonnaded facade and a domed roofline. The inscription 'Bratislava' appears in the field above the building. The legend 'SLOVENSKÁ REPUBLIKA' runs along the upper portion of the copper-nickel outer ring, with the date '2004' positioned at the base. Twelve stars, symbolic of the European Union, are evenly spaced around the inner ring border. |

| Reverse description | The central nordic gold disc features a large numeral '2' occupying the left portion of the field, accompanied by a kneeling female figure to the right harvesting a sheaf of wheat, rendered in a classical allegorical style. The copper-nickel outer ring bears the multilingual trial/pattern inscriptions 'TRIAL · ESSAI' along the upper arc and 'PROBE · PRUEBA' along the lower arc, separated by twelve stars of the European Union evenly distributed around the ring. |
